    **Foreword INDIE Awards 2020 GOLD Winner for Family & Relationships**

    It sometimes seems like everyone has a big, happy, fulfilling social life, full of lifelong friendships...except you. As we grow older and school friendships fade, it can be difficult to meet new people and cultivate meaningful friendships. How do you strike up a conversation with a stranger? How do you move from mutual acquaintances to real friends?

    Here to Make Friends has the answers to all of these questions and more. Written by a licensed therapist, this book is packed full of helpful advice and tips to overcome social anxiety and start building a stronger social circle, such as:

     
    • Tips for moving past small talk
    • Advice for getting out of your own head
    • Suggestions for fun and memorable “friend dates”
    • Strategies for connecting meaningfully with other people



    Everyone wants to feel connected. Here to Make Friends is the perfect companion for moving past the sometimes-lonely post-school stage and into lasting, fulfilling friendships.
